Three Key Ball Striking Tips I Took Away

Here are the three insights that will stick with me every round:

  1. Move the ball position back slightly
    Too many of us push the ball forward, chasing height. That often causes hooks or slices. A subtle shift back helps you strike down and compress the ball.

  2. Narrow the stance by a thumb-width
    A stance that’s too wide locks up your hips. A shoulder-width setup lets your pelvis turn freely, boosting rotation and power.

  3. Control the sway with a weighted-release drill
    By pressing lightly into that back-foot plate and then releasing, you learn to turn into the swing rather than drift away from the ball.

No complicated mechanics. Just three practical ball striking tips that anyone can practise anywhere—indoors or out.
